[edit] Premise
The Maquis - Soldier of Peace was a three-issue comic book miniseries from Malibu Comics released between February 1995 and April 1995. This series featured the cast of Star Trek: Deep Space Nine, focusing on Julian Bashir, and is set a few months after the events of VOY: "Caretaker". By its stardate, it takes place between the events of DS9: "Destiny" and "Visionary" in the third season of DS9.
A four page prelude story was presented in issue #18 of the monthly series, "Hearts of Old", called "Wargames". This story was set immediately before the events of VOY: "Caretaker".
[edit] Creators
- Based on:
- Star Trek created by Gene Roddenberry
- Star Trek: Deep Space Nine created by Rick Berman and Michael Piller
- Writer: Mark A. Altman
- Artists:
- Pencils: Rob Davis
- Inkers: Terry Pallot and Jack Snider
- Letters: Ronnie Cruz and Roxanne Starr
- Editors:
- Mark Paniccia
- Clarissa Manansala (assistant editor)
